5.0 out of 5 stars This book made a lasting impression on my, October 21, 2011
By 
This review is from: The King of the Golden City, An Allegory for Children (Paperback)
I was born into a very Roman Catholic family and like most little girls in the 1950s, I had all kinds of religious books, my Missal, rosaries, and attended multiple instruction classes on Thursdays and Saturdays, throughout my childhood. Years later, I struck out on my own like many people did in the 1970s, looking for answers outside of the Catholic Church.

Still, throughout my life, I kept a close relationship with my Catholic roots and in particular treasured this book, which had been my mother's when she was little. I have the original copy with a delicate line drawing of Jesus and Dilecta, the little girl in the story with whom I had so closely identified, on the cover. The image of that cover stayed with me throughout my life when I had inadvertently misplaced my copy among the many boxes of books one accumulates over one's lifetime.

I recently rediscovered my copy and am now ready to send out new copies to any child that I think would appreciate its gentle story of goodness and kindness that are not confined to Christianity but certainly reflect the true message and teachings of Christ.

If someone is looking for a simple, clear and yet profound way to reach the heart of a child about the role of God, Jesus and moral strength through the Roman Catholic religion, this is the book to get them. Many adults would do well to read it too, and reaquaint themselves with Jesus's example and message to us, so many years later. It resonates with crystal precision through Mother Mary Loyola's own life story and the dear little book she left us as only one of her lasting legacies.
